O Amazon Redshift não permitirá mais a criação de funções definidas pelo usuário (UDFs) do Python a partir de 1.º de novembro de 2025. Se quiser usar UDFs do Python, você deve criá-las antes dessa data. As UDFs do Python existentes continuarão a funcionar normalmente. Para ter mais informações, consulte a publicação de blog
Tipo HLLSKETCH
Use o tipo de dados HLLSKETCH para esboços do HyperLogLog. O Amazon Redshift oferece suporte a representações de esboço do HyperLogLog que são esparsas ou densas. Os esboços começam como esparsos e mudam para denso quando o formato denso é mais eficiente para minimizar o espaço de memória usado.
O Amazon Redshift faz a transição automática de um esboço do HyperLogLog esparso ao importar, exportar ou imprimir esboços no seguinte formato JSON.
{"logm":15,"sparse":{"indices":[4878,9559,14523],"values":[1,2,1]}}
O Amazon Redshift usa uma representação de string em um formato Base64 para representar um esboço denso do HyperLogLog.
O Amazon Redshift usa a seguinte representação de string em um formato Base64 para representar um esboço denso do HyperLogLog.
"ABAABA..."
O tamanho máximo de um objeto HLLSKETCH é 24.580 bytes quando usado na compactação bruta.